What Is Drug Abuse?

Friday, September 18th, 2009

The significance of “drug abuse” is described as the using up of psychoactive drugs and sports performance enhancement drugs for non-medical purposes. Some examples of oppressed drugs include alcohol, barbiturates, morphine, benzodiazepines, cocaine, heroin, amphetamines, and other opiates like hydrocodone and codeine.

Drug abuse involves the unwarranted and recurring use of a substance to escape actuality to derive pleasure despite its negative effects. The substances abused can be illegal drugs such as opium, cocaine, marijuana and their derivatives or legal substances used improperly, such as prescription drugs and inhalants like nail polish or gasoline.

Craving for drugs is seen in all age groups due to reasons like physical, emotional, or both. Physical addiction refers to the physiological effects of drug use. Alternatively, using a drug to numb unlikable feelings, to relax, or to satisfy cravings are examples of mental addiction.

Drug testing at work, saliva drug test, clinical drug test, laboratory drug test, and several other methods of drug testing is used to detect abuse.

Since substance abuse and drug obsession can cause impairment to an individual, it is imperative to persuade the drug-addicted individual to get drug addiction treatment. The challenge to stop the misuse of drugs falls short most of the time. While there are a number of proofs of short-term feats, the long-term feats are still uncommon.

There are a number of healing processes that were invented to help drug dependents discontinue their drug obsession. The treatment methodologies consist of various approaches like damage minimization, abstinence-based systems, remedial treatments, and legal ways. The drug abuse treatment processes are separated into two groups. The first class includes a number of common drug abuse treatment services while the second set includes the criminal justice involved treatment procedures.

There are four key types of testing the drug abuse by taking the samples: Urine, Hair, Saliva, and Blood. Most common is the urine test, which has the advantage of being reasonably priced and less meddling than the blood test.
